Since the start of the Covid-19 pandemic, Spain had implemented very strict rules concerning travelers wishing to enter the territory. As of today, these are lifted.

Indeed, the Spanish government has just made major changes to the travel restrictions put in place in 2020 with the aim of limiting the spread of the virus in the country and thus protecting its population. For a large number of travelers wishing to stay in Spain, these measures had caused enormous difficulties when crossing the border. In particular, it was necessary to present proof of vaccination or a test Covid-19 negative in the controls.

Spain was one of the last European countries to apply such strict restrictions to foreign travellers. Thanks to this good news, it will now be much easier to visit the country, and when you know that this destination is one of the most popular in Europe, this should delight many people. “As of October 21, 2022, the restrictions regarding the Covid-19 test and the vaccination certificate will be lifted” can we read on the website of the Spanish tourist board.

Some restrictions remain in place

If the measures concerning the entry into Spain are over, not all the rules about Covid-19 are. For example, it is still mandatory to wear a face mask on public transport and inside airplanes. Ditto for anyone over the age of six if they go to a hospital, medical center, retirement home or any other health facility such as dentists and opticians. On the other hand, masks are not compulsory in airports, ports or train stations.
